2013-03-22 5 views
1

모든 변경 요청 (애자일 프로젝트이므로 2 주마다 하나씩)에 대해 새 SVN 태그를 생성하고이를 지우기 퀘스트에 연결하는 것이 좋습니다 나중에 감사를 위해 티켓을보고 태그 URL을 클릭하고 브라우저 창에서 변경된 내용을 볼 수 있습니다 (SVN 서버는 VisualSVN에서 호스팅됩니다).수정 링크가 포함 된 고유 링크 SVN

유지 관리의 악몽이 아니겠습니까? 6 개월 후에는 12 개의 태그를보고 비상 사태가 발생할 경우 더 빠르게 성장할 수 있습니다.

이 문제에 대한 최선의 방법을 알고 싶습니다. 다시 문제는 다음과 같습니다.

엄청난 양의 태그를 만들지 않고 링크로 Clear Quest에 SVN 변경 세트를 제공하십시오.

트렁크의 리비전이있는 링크를 클릭하여 브라우저에서 클릭하여 브라우저에서 변경 사항을 직접 볼 수 있습니까?

감사합니다.

답변

1

우선 당신이 정말로하고 싶은 것은 문제 추적기와 SVN 사이에 일종의 통합이 있다고 생각하는 것 같습니다. 당신이하는 일에 대해 어떻게하는가는 당신의 태그에 기반한 이슈 추적기에 달려 있습니다. 이러한 통합 작업은 일반적으로 어떻게 https://confluence.atlassian.com/display/JIRA/Integrating+JIRA+with+Subversion

당신이 해결하고있는 문제를 언급 커밋 메시지에서 뭔가를 포함

여기에 SVN으로 JIRA를 통합하는 방법에 대한 몇 가지 정보입니다. 또 다른 대안은 리비전 속성이지만 좀 지루할 수 있습니다.

원래 질문에 답변 할 수있는 것 외. viewvc와 같은 것을 원할 수도 있습니다 : http://www.viewvc.org/

멋진 웹 인터페이스를 제공합니다. 우리의 viewvc보기로 리디렉션 같은 URL을 가지고있는 ASF에서 예를 들어, 커밋 : 우리가 다음 등 이메일, 이슈 트래커에 포함 할 수 있습니다 http://svn.apache.org/r1460019

...

+0

죄송합니다 제가 '년후 가정 더 분명해. 내가 가진 문제는 CQ 설명에서 링크로 티켓에 들어가는 SVN 변경 사항을 제공하는 것입니다. –

+1

당신이 정말로 필요로하는 것은 당신이 필요로하는 개정판을 나열하는 것입니다 (만약 당신이 viewvc와 같은 것을 필요로 할 것 같은 당신의 변화에 ​​대한 예쁜 관점을 원한다면). 많은 수정이 필요하다면, 기능 브랜치를 사용하는 것이 더 나을 것입니다. –

+0

나의 나쁜 나는 당신이 대답에서 제공 한 아파치 링크를 읽지 않았다. 두 가지 접근 방식 중 어느 것을 선호합니까 –

관련 문제